Who is the parent company of Travelers insurance?

In the 1990s, Travelers went through a series of mergers and acquisitions. It was bought by Primerica in December 1993, but the resulting company retained the Travelers name. In 1995 it became The Travelers Group.

Is Standard Fire Insurance Company the same as Travelers?

The Standard Fire Insurance Company was incorporated on July 6, 1905 and commenced business on March 26, 1910 under the laws of Connecticut. The company is wholly owned by Travelers Insurance Group Holdings Inc., a wholly-owned subsidiary of Travelers Property Casualty Corp.

Who is Standard fire auto insurance company?

The Standard Fire Insurance Company is an insurance company based in Hartford, Connecticut. Established in 1905, the firm provides property, fire, automobile, burglary, and casualty insurance services. The company operates as a subsidiary of Travelers Insurance Group Holdings.

How old is Alan Schnitzer?

About 56 years (1965)
Alan D. Schnitzer/Age
Schnitzer (born 1965) is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of The Travelers Companies, Inc., a leading provider of property casualty insurance for auto, home and business. He was previously Vice Chairman of Travelers, and Chief Executive Officer of the company’s Business and International Insurance segment.
